Bomgar logo Bomgar

Access any remote desktop, server, or POS system through firewalls - no VPN! Bomgar supports Windows, Mac, Linux, iPad, iPhone, and Android. Appliance or Cloud deployment options.

ConEmu logo ConEmu

ConEmu-Maximus5 is a full-featured local terminal for Windows devs, admins and users. Get better console window with tabs, splits, Quake style, copy+paste, DosBox and PuTTY integration, and much more.

ConEmu Reviews

7 Best Free Terminal Emulators For Windows 10/11 in 2022
It is free and open-source software that is built on the popular console emulator known as ConEmu. It is used to add enhancements from clink that provide bash style completion. Moreover, it also presents UNIX capabilities by extending them with PowerShell, MinnTTY, myysgit and Cygwin.
30 best PuTTY alternatives for SSH clients for 2020
Cmder is a straight-forward terminal emulator for Windows. The program runs on Windows and it is a combination of the ConEmu terminal emulation program with a Unix-like scripting language that works on Windows. The terminal emulator doesn’t have any encryption, so it would only be suitable for connections on private networks. The tool also lacks a file transfer system.
